For the money you pay this is a decent hostel the hostal is a 25 min bus journey from the centre of punta del este but is close to good beaches. Each bus journey to the centre is 28 pesos one way. The directions supplied on how to get there could be a lot better. The pin indicating the location of the hostal on google maps is actually 3km away.

Nice hostel, good atmosphere and usefull/kind/nice staff. The only thing is that the hostel is placed in Manantiales and not in Punta del Este (Manatiales is about 15-20min from Punta). Manantiales is a small town and lot of things happen there during summer (also in La Barra), but if you want to be in Punta it might not be your place (anyway we went two nights to party at Punta).
